United Democratic Movement leader Bantu Holomisa, who plays off a 10 handicap, will be among several personalities who are expected to compete in a fundraising golf day in Eastern Cape on Saturday.

The one-day event will be held at the Uitenhage Golf Course and is expected to draw a full field. Tee-off is at 7am.

It is hosted by businessman Butityi Konki, boss of BK Investment Holding, and will be played over 18 holes.

"The objective of the contest is to raise funds that will be used to stage the golf tournament at the schools level in April," explained Konki, who will be celebrating his 50th birthday on the same day.

Amateur golfers from previously disadvantaged areas will get an opportunity to develop their skills in a competitive event.

Other celebrities expected to take part include former Springbok flyhalf Naas Botha and erstwhile Springbok manager Zola Yeye.

The entry fee will be R150 a player and companies will be sponsoring some holes.
